I'm experiencing a strange issue with Figma Presentation on macOS (Desktop app), and it happens across all files.
Problem
When I click “Present”:
- It opens two windows
- One is a black screen
- The other shows Page 1 / Frame 1, not the frame I selected
- Even if I’m working on another page (e.g. Page 22), it still jumps to Page 1
- The presentation basically becomes unusable
Important detail
Right after launching Figma, everything works normally for a few seconds.
But after a short time:
- The issue comes back
- Presentation breaks again (wrong page + black window)
What I already tried
Figma-related
- Set correct Flow starting point
- Used Shift + Enter / Option + Cmd + Enter
- Right-click → Present
- Checked Prototype panel (no conflicting flows)
- Happens on all files, including new ones
macOS-related
- Disabled Stage Manager
- Disabled “Displays have separate Spaces”
- Restarted Mac
- No external monitor connected
Environment check
- ✅ Works perfectly in browser version
- ❌ Only broken in Figma Desktop app
My guess
This seems like a conflict between:
- Figma Desktop (presentation window)
- macOS window / Spaces management
It looks like macOS is reassigning the presentation window after a few seconds.
